What Is Perimeter Pest Control?
Perimeter pest control focuses on treating the exterior of your home—creating a protective barrier that stops pests before they ever make it inside. Instead of reacting to bugs once they’re in your home, this approach prevents them from getting in at all.

Why It Matters Right Now
As the ground thaws and moisture levels rise, pests like ants, spiders, and earwigs become more active. They’re searching for food, water, and shelter—and your home checks all the boxes.

Starting treatments now means:

  • You stop pests at the source
  • You reduce the chance of indoor infestations
  • You avoid bigger (and more expensive) problems later

How It Works
Our perimeter treatments are applied around the foundation of your home, entry points, and problem areas. This creates an invisible barrier that keeps pests out while remaining safe for your family and pets when used as directed.
